Arsenal have two of the seven most valuable teenagers in world football in Ethan Nwaneri and Myles Lewis-Skelly, according to one statistical model.

Barcelona, Chelsea and Real Madrid are the other clubs with multiple players in the top 10. The Blues have Estevao and Geovany Quenda, the latter of whom they agreed to sign last summer.

Lamine Yamal leads the way with a value exceeding £300million and Estevao ranks second at just over £100million. Yamal's teammate, Pau Cubarsi, is next at £99million, with Madrid's Franco Mastantuono fourth at £90million.

Paris Saint-Germain midfielder Warren Zaire-Emery comes in at £81million for sixth, just above both Arsenal academy graduates.

Nwaneri ranks higher with a value of £77million, which is £2million more than his team-mate Lewis-Skelly. It means the pair are worth a whopping £152m to Arsenal.
